Produktbeschreibung
Waiting for Rain by Mary Fox provides poetry that relates to the ordinary person and is suitable for tweens, teens, and adults, touching on common issues in family relations, illness, bullying, and break ups. The author says of the collection: "In collecting the poems, I focused on the moments that people live in between life's more dramatic events-times we are left waiting, resting, hoping, evaluating, mourning, or expecting what might come. When we wait for rain, we can hope for growth, change or relief but we also can think of rain as interrupting our progress, flooding our plans, or in some other way "raining on our parade," as the cliché says. I wanted poems that captured those reflective moments of life, our reactions, when we step back and look for meaning and enlightenment."
Autorenporträt
Mary Fox, a Detroit-born poet, currently resides in Portland, MI. She graduated from Michigan State University (BA) and Central Michigan University (MS.). In 2016, she published Waiing for Rain, a poetry chapbook, with Finishing Line Press and in 2018, co-edited Promptly Speaking, the fourth Writing at the Ledges anthology, to publication.
